From c1dc1c0c3901674517f3ecad39866304c4085c61 Mon Sep 17 00:00:00 2001 From: Nekura Date: Wed, 6 May 2026 11:09:05 +0200 Subject: [PATCH] Added Kura Depot --- DATA/MISSIONS/mbases.ini | 78 ++++++++++++++++++ .../SYSTEMS/Ku08/BASES/KU08_05_Base.ini | 12 +++ .../Ku08/BASES/ROOMS/KU08_05_Base_bar.ini | 46 +++++++++++ .../Ku08/BASES/ROOMS/KU08_05_Base_deck.ini | 78 ++++++++++++++++++ DATA/UNIVERSE/SYSTEMS/Ku08/KU08.ini | 27 +++--- DATA/UNIVERSE/universe.ini | 6 ++ EXE/FLAtlas_resources.dll | Bin 1536 -> 2048 bytes FLAtlas-Change.log | 19 +++++ 8 files changed, 256 insertions(+), 10 deletions(-) create mode 100644 DATA/UNIVERSE/SYSTEMS/Ku08/BASES/KU08_05_Base.ini create mode 100644 DATA/UNIVERSE/SYSTEMS/Ku08/BASES/ROOMS/KU08_05_Base_bar.ini create mode 100644 DATA/UNIVERSE/SYSTEMS/Ku08/BASES/ROOMS/KU08_05_Base_deck.ini diff --git a/DATA/MISSIONS/mbases.ini b/DATA/MISSIONS/mbases.ini index 2ed866ed..5d0fd80c 100644 --- a/DATA/MISSIONS/mbases.ini +++ b/DATA/MISSIONS/mbases.ini @@ -46698,3 +46698,81 @@ fixture = ku08_04_base_equipment_npc_01, Zs/NPC/Equipment/01/A/Stand, scripts\ve nickname = ShipDealer character_density = 2 fixture = ku08_04_base_shipdealer_npc_01, Zs/NPC/ShipDealer/01/A/Stand, scripts\vendors\li_shipdealer_fidget.thn, ShipDealer + +[MBase] +nickname = KU08_05_Base +local_faction = sh_n_grp +diff = 1 +msg_id_prefix = gcs_refer_base_KU08_05_Base + +[MVendor] +num_offers = 0, 0 + +[BaseFaction] +faction = fc_bd_grp +weight = 10 +npc = ku08_05_base_bar_npc_01 +npc = ku08_05_base_bar_npc_02 + +[GF_NPC] +nickname = ku08_05_base_bar_npc_01 +body = br_male_elite_body +head = pl_male6_head +lefthand = benchmark_female_hand_left +righthand = benchmark_female_hand_right +room = bar +individual_name = 524297 +affiliation = fc_bd_grp +voice = mc_leg_m01 + +[GF_NPC] +nickname = ku08_05_base_bar_npc_02 +body = rh_shipdealer_body +head = ku_tenji_head +lefthand = benchmark_female_hand_left +righthand = benchmark_female_hand_right +room = bar +individual_name = 524298 +affiliation = fc_bd_grp +voice = mc_leg_m01 + +[GF_NPC] +nickname = ku08_05_base_bar_npc_03 +body = benchmark_female_body +head = li_newscaster_head_hat +lefthand = benchmark_male_hand_left +righthand = benchmark_male_hand_right +individual_name = 524299 +affiliation = sh_n_grp +voice = mc_leg_m01 + +[GF_NPC] +nickname = ku08_05_base_deck_npc_01 +body = pl_female1_peasant_body +head = ge_male3_head +lefthand = benchmark_male_hand_left +righthand = benchmark_male_hand_right +individual_name = 524300 +affiliation = sh_n_grp +voice = mc_leg_m01 + +[GF_NPC] +nickname = ku08_05_base_deck_npc_02 +body = li_bartender_body +head = sh_female1_head_gen +lefthand = benchmark_male_hand_left +righthand = benchmark_male_hand_right +individual_name = 524301 +affiliation = sh_n_grp +voice = mc_leg_m01 + +[MRoom] +nickname = Deck +character_density = 3 +fixture = ku08_05_base_deck_npc_01, Zs/NPC/trader/01/A/Stand, scripts\vendors\li_commtrader_fidget.thn, trader +fixture = ku08_05_base_deck_npc_02, Zs/NPC/Equipment/01/A/Stand, scripts\vendors\li_equipdealer_fidget.thn, Equipment + +[MRoom] +nickname = bar +character_density = 7 +fixture = ku08_05_base_bar_npc_03, Zs/NPC/Bartender/01/A/Stand, scripts\vendors\li_host_fidget.thn, bartender diff --git a/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/KU08_05_Base.ini b/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/KU08_05_Base.ini new file mode 100644 index 00000000..69072320 --- /dev/null +++ b/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/KU08_05_Base.ini @@ -0,0 +1,12 @@ +[BaseInfo] +nickname = KU08_05_Base +start_room = Deck +price_variance = 0.00 + +[Room] +nickname = Deck +file = Universe\Systems\KU08\Bases\Rooms\KU08_05_Base_deck.ini + +[Room] +nickname = Bar +file = Universe\Systems\KU08\Bases\Rooms\KU08_05_Base_bar.ini diff --git a/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/ROOMS/KU08_05_Base_bar.ini b/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/ROOMS/KU08_05_Base_bar.ini new file mode 100644 index 00000000..be44abb9 --- /dev/null +++ b/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/ROOMS/KU08_05_Base_bar.ini @@ -0,0 +1,46 @@ +[Room_Info] +set_script = scripts\bases\ku_08_Bar_hardpoint_L6.thn +scene = ambient, scripts\bases\ku_08_bar_ambi_Ku05_02.thn +scene = ambient, scripts\bases\Ambi_Nebula_Puffs_Norm.thn +scene = ambient, scripts\bases\Ambi_Lightning.thn + +[Room_Sound] +music = music_bar_generic05 +ambient = ambience_deck_space_smaller + +[CharacterPlacement] +name = Zg/PC/Player/01/A/Stand +start_script = Scripts\Bases\ku_08_bar_enter_01.thn + +[Camera] +name = Camera_0 + +[Hotspot] +name = IDS_HOTSPOT_DECK +behavior = ExitDoor +room_switch = Deck + +[Hotspot] +name = IDS_HOTSPOT_BAR +behavior = ExitDoor +room_switch = Bar + +[Hotspot] +name = IDS_HOTSPOT_COMMODITYTRADER_ROOM +behavior = ExitDoor +room_switch = Deck +set_virtual_room = Trader + +[Hotspot] +name = IDS_HOTSPOT_EQUIPMENTDEALER_ROOM +behavior = ExitDoor +room_switch = Deck +set_virtual_room = Equipment + +[Hotspot] +name = IDS_HOTSPOT_NEWSVENDOR +behavior = NewsVendor + +[Hotspot] +name = IDS_HOTSPOT_MISSIONVENDOR +behavior = MissionVendor diff --git a/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/ROOMS/KU08_05_Base_deck.ini b/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/ROOMS/KU08_05_Base_deck.ini new file mode 100644 index 00000000..0650a478 --- /dev/null +++ b/DATA/UNIVERSE/SYSTEMS/Ku08/BASES/ROOMS/KU08_05_Base_deck.ini @@ -0,0 +1,78 @@ +[Room_Info] +set_script = Scripts\Bases\ku_07_Deck_hardpoint_01.thn +scene = all, ambient, Scripts\Bases\ku_07_Deck_ambi_int_01.thn +animation = Sc_loop + +[Room_Sound] +ambient = ambience_deck_space_larger + +[PlayerShipPlacement] +name = X/Shipcentre/01 + +[Camera] +name = Camera_0 + +[Hotspot] +name = IDS_HOTSPOT_DECK +behavior = ExitDoor +room_switch = Deck + +[Hotspot] +name = IDS_HOTSPOT_BAR +behavior = ExitDoor +room_switch = Bar + +[Hotspot] +name = IDS_HOTSPOT_COMMODITYTRADER_ROOM +behavior = VirtualRoom +room_switch = Trader + +[Hotspot] +name = IDS_HOTSPOT_EQUIPMENTDEALER_ROOM +behavior = VirtualRoom +room_switch = Equipment + +[Hotspot] +name = IDS_NN_REPAIR_YOUR_SHIP +behavior = ExitDoor +room_switch = Deck + +[Hotspot] +name = IDS_DEALER_FRONT_DESK +behavior = FrontDesk +state_read = 1 +state_send = 2 +virtual_room = Trader + +[Hotspot] +name = IDS_HOTSPOT_COMMODITYTRADER +behavior = StartDealer +state_read = 2 +state_send = 1 +virtual_room = Trader + +[Hotspot] +name = IDS_DEALER_FRONT_DESK +behavior = FrontDesk +state_read = 1 +state_send = 2 +virtual_room = Equipment + +[Hotspot] +name = IDS_HOTSPOT_EQUIPMENTDEALER +behavior = StartEquipDealer +state_read = 2 +state_send = 1 +virtual_room = Equipment + +[Hotspot] +name = IDS_EQUIPMENT_ROOM_RIGHT +behavior = MoveRight +state_read = 2 +state_send = 1 +virtual_room = Equipment + +[Hotspot] +name = IDS_NN_REPAIR_YOUR_SHIP +behavior = Repair +virtual_room = Equipment diff --git a/DATA/UNIVERSE/SYSTEMS/Ku08/KU08.ini b/DATA/UNIVERSE/SYSTEMS/Ku08/KU08.ini index b1b6c093..6cf9a9f1 100644 --- a/DATA/UNIVERSE/SYSTEMS/Ku08/KU08.ini +++ b/DATA/UNIVERSE/SYSTEMS/Ku08/KU08.ini @@ -615,16 +615,6 @@ loadout = trade_lane_ring_ku_01 pilot = pilot_solar_easiest reputation = sh_n_grp -[Object] -nickname = KU08_Depot_001 -ids_name = 0 -ids_info = 0 -pos = -31039.46, 0.00, 19622.46 -rotate = 0,0,0 -archetype = depot -loadout = depot -reputation = sh_n_grp - [Object] nickname = KU08_planet_002 ids_name = 0 @@ -1147,3 +1137,20 @@ encounter = tradelane_trade_freighter, 12, 0.500000 faction = sh_corp_grp encounter = tradelane_trade_transport, 12, 0.500000 faction = sh_corp_grp + +[Object] +nickname = KU08_05 +pos = -31096.34, 0.00, 17707.64 +rotate = 0, 0, 0 +ids_name = 524295 +ids_info = 524296 +Archetype = depot +dock_with = KU08_05_Base +base = KU08_05_Base +behavior = NOTHING +difficulty_level = 1 +loadout = depot +pilot = pilot_solar_hardest +reputation = sh_n_grp +voice = atc_leg_m01 +space_costume = benchmark_male_head, benchmark_male_body diff --git a/DATA/UNIVERSE/universe.ini b/DATA/UNIVERSE/universe.ini index 267aadd8..8b790239 100644 --- a/DATA/UNIVERSE/universe.ini +++ b/DATA/UNIVERSE/universe.ini @@ -2396,3 +2396,9 @@ nickname = KU08_04_Base system = KU08 strid_name = 500016 file = Universe\Systems\KU08\Bases\KU08_04_Base.ini + +[Base] +nickname = KU08_05_Base +system = KU08 +strid_name = 524295 +file = Universe\Systems\KU08\Bases\KU08_05_Base.ini diff --git a/EXE/FLAtlas_resources.dll b/EXE/FLAtlas_resources.dll index bdb3809cf1bb0476e30046e359fba636f8885b51..94302368737c154067ad66a1afeaf23783393b1b 100755 GIT binary patch literal 2048 zcmeHH&2AD=6#j;)v6>KE8PkOqbZfCDHrgNo%MhCKGa1Izx*L9^6JQ31!L~b>E`0??ZoF{0=brQ3@BD_^yAx;tZg9s}A%3|+KA}GO@JABg z*3Z)4wdz^gI&#Kp25v-3>~Oy8qU{#I}!a) zB+_@a(4^NFtl!0*3Ui7*@me7aBfFL+*#LJMcbSfam8;L#HOI%~T?LZk-Kf1&jG9xzy= zFk4?)lk@1pGiR2n`JC~lS;^*emj2et?^cV==8kH7?D_-G@8q(fHfI#g;v8b?2RkaV zSY}bRJz`&F9+k^axiWL0aP5`%^wJV=r~BTX3<3ei$%|&KSkvp)iVkK}M#CU)RXcY65CJxVVElx;UoQ;=PYk{wll<-vqR{=6+$G|(l3{? z)TKg%ypw*GD7P7*Lu-$Bb0(!2xuB&_;?t$A88TjUT_!_#rumPE3OF?z?EHYT#3>d* z^g@O)CqSV_58_Yau$hG&_TIVn-F`S%eKIK=@|DzB`nSQjWOihlq^B}*%csv|WEP%a hi=S;|mcF~b%5j#hD_E|d#tW8bcpm#_`7cTZ{s8`Z{-yu` delta 114 zcmZn=XyBR9AZ2&@dnN-EJYZl_